Output 64e958bcf9579e6d8b0bc57f57315f796cc9b84cf996b4ab147d6963ffd9a84e:0

value
1000042
script pubkey
OP_0 OP_PUSHBYTES_20 d8ba9784a598ffa0a6ddf75c83e868774c94e8ce
address
bc1qmzaf0p99nrl6pfka7awg86rgwaxff6xwmvkyxy
transaction
64e958bcf9579e6d8b0bc57f57315f796cc9b84cf996b4ab147d6963ffd9a84e
spent
true